  • Abstract
    In this paper, we propose the pseudo multi-hop distributed consensus algorithm under directed communication topologies. The property and convergence rate of the pseudo multi-hop distributed consensus algorithm under directed communication topologies are analyzed, and the convergence conditions for the pseudo multi-hop distributed consensus algorithm is given. In particular, the convergence rate is determined by the spectral radius of the matrix depend on the communication topology. Finally, simulation results are provided to verify these analytical results.
